Reland [lld-macho] Fix bug in reading cpuSubType field.

This reverts commit 66692c822a.

New changes:
  - update test to require aarch64
  - update test to not hard-code cpu[sub] type values (since they could change)
  - update test to temporarily skip windows (because llvm-mc on windows doesn't seem to work with triple arm64-apple-macos)

Differential Revision: https://reviews.llvm.org/D139572

@@ -231,8 +231,14 @@ std::optional<MemoryBufferRef> macho::readFile(StringRef path) {
return std::nullopt;
}
if (read32be(&arch[i].cputype) != static_cast<uint32_t>(target->cpuType) ||
read32be(&arch[i].cpusubtype) != target->cpuSubtype)
uint32_t cpuType = read32be(&arch[i].cputype);
uint32_t cpuSubtype =
read32be(&arch[i].cpusubtype) & ~MachO::CPU_SUBTYPE_MASK;
// FIXME: LD64 has a more complex fallback logic here.
// Consider implementing that as well?
if (cpuType != static_cast<uint32_t>(target->cpuType) ||
cpuSubtype != target->cpuSubtype)
continue;
uint32_t offset = read32be(&arch[i].offset);
